Acceptance.

Acceptance of what IS allows  space for movement.

We may think that acceptance means we are giving into or find our predicament acceptable.

This is not so.

We can take a breath and accept this moment is what it is.

No amount of fight, or struggle, denial or resistance can change what IS.

But that one moment, that one breath of acceptance allows the energy holding so tight to become flexible, and there is a spacious freedom for WHAT IS to change and transcend into new. ❤️
